Following are some examples: In a one home computer environment anyone who uses the computer can read this file but cannot write to modify it. This enables users to be treated temporarily as root or another user. This command will do the trick: However, this is not a problem since the permissions of symbolic links are never used.
Mac OS X versions When set for a directory, the execute permission is interpreted as the search permission: However, for each symbolic link listed on the command linechmod changes the permissions of the pointed-to file.
You will have to deal with it. These special modes are for a file or directory overall, not by a class, though in the symbolic read write access chmod permissions see below the setuid bit is set in the triad for the user, the setgid bit is set in the triad for the group and the sticky bit is set in the triad for others.
So, in laymen terms, if you wanted a file to be readable by everyone, and writable by only you, you would write the chmod command with the following structure.
It contains a comprehensive description of how to define and express file permissions. The effective permissions are determined based on the first class the user falls within in the order of user, group then others.
Unlike ACL-based systems, permissions on Unix-like systems are not inherited. Recursive chmod with -R and sudo To change all the permissions of each file and folder under a specified directory at once, use sudo chmod with -R user host: When set for a directory, this permission grants the ability to read the names of files in the directory, but not to find out any further information about them such as contents, file type, size, ownership, permissions.
Overview On Linux and other Unix -like operating systemsthere is a set of rules for each file which defines who can access that file, and how they can access it.
Linux can establish different types of groups for file access. Therefore, when setting permissions, you are assigning them for yourself, "your group" and "everyone else" in the world.
You have been warned. Once Joe has copied the files, Fred will probably want to change the mode of his home directory so that it is no longer accessible to the world at large.
Distinct permissions apply to the owner. When a file with setgid is executed, the resulting process will assume the group ID given to the group class. Three permission triads what the owner can do second triad what the group members can do third triad what other users can do Each triad.
For example, to view the permissions of file. It belongs to bob in particular and it is one 1 file. This is basically because it was conceived as a networked system where different people would be using a variety of programs, files, etc.
Root owns the file and it is in the group "root". A directory, for example, would have a d instead of a dash. This command will produce a message similar to the following: The changes are in the owner and group.
The letters r, w, x, X, s and t select file mode bits for the affected users: Each digit is a combination of the numbers 4, 2, 1, and 0: The commas separate the different classes of permissions, and there are no spaces in between them.Nov 10, · (Caution: write access for a directory allows deleting of files in the directory even if the user does not have write permissions for the file!
execute restricts or. crw-rw-r a character special file whose user and group classes have the read and write permissions and whose others class has only the read permission. dr-x a directory whose user class has read and execute permissions and whose group and others classes have no permissions.
In Unix-like operating systems, chmod is the command and system call which may change the access permissions to file system objects (files and directories). sets read and write permissions for owner and group, and provides read to others. chmod mint-body.com: sets read, write.
As a regular user, you do not have read or write access to this file for security reasons, but when you change your password, you need to have the write permission to this file.
This means that the passwd program has to give you additional permissions so that you can write to the file /etc/shadow. chmod file - Allow read permission to owner and group and world chmod file - Allow everyone to read, write, and execute file.
Read: r: Write: w: Execute (or access for directories) x: Execute only if the file is a directory (or already has execute permission for some user) X. Jun 25, · After the two dashes (two here because there is no write permissions for the group) come the overall user permissions.
Anyone who might have access to the computer from inside or outside (in the case of a network) can read this file.Download